Australia`s import trend for the lifeboat market experienced significant growth from 2023 to 2024, with a remarkable increase of 163.32%. The compound annual growth rate (CAGR) for the period of 2020-2024 stood at 31.61%. This surge in imports may be attributed to a heightened demand for maritime safety equipment or shifts in trade policies that favored importing lifeboats.

The Australia lifeboat market serves maritime industries, including shipping, offshore oil and gas, and marine transportation, with essential safety equipment. Lifeboats, along with life rafts and rescue boats, are vital for emergency evacuation and survival at sea, ensuring compliance with maritime regulations and enhancing maritime safety standards.
The Australia lifeboat market is influenced by factors such as the increasing maritime safety regulations and standards, the growing awareness about passenger and crew safety onboard ships and offshore installations, and advancements in lifeboat design and technology. Lifeboats are essential marine safety equipment used for evacuating passengers and crew from ships and offshore platforms during emergencies such as fires, collisions, or sinking incidents. Factors driving market growth include the expanding maritime industry, the rising demand for offshore oil and gas exploration and production activities, and the focus on improving safety and evacuation procedures. Moreover, advancements in lifeboat materials, construction techniques, and launching systems contribute to market expansion by offering enhanced reliability, maneuverability, and capacity for rescue operations. As shipping companies and offshore operators prioritize compliance with safety regulations and risk mitigation strategies, the demand for lifeboats is expected to continue increasing, driving market growth.
In the Australia lifeboat market, challenges stem from regulatory compliance, technological advancements, and market demand fluctuations. While lifeboats are critical safety equipment for maritime vessels, ensuring compliance with international safety regulations and standards, such as SOLAS (Safety of Life at Sea), poses challenges for manufacturers and shipowners. Additionally, integrating new technologies and materials to improve lifeboat design and performance requires continuous innovation and investment. Moreover, market demand fluctuations, driven by factors such as shipbuilding activity and maritime safety regulations, impact sales volumes and production schedules, requiring agile manufacturing and supply chain strategies to meet market demands.
Australia government regulations regarding lifeboats may focus on safety standards, equipment certification, and emergency preparedness requirements for maritime vessels. Policies aim to protect passengers and crew members by ensuring the availability of properly maintained and equipped lifeboats for emergency evacuation situations.

Export potential enables firms to identify high-growth global markets with greater confidence by combining advanced trade intelligence with a structured quantitative methodology. The framework analyzes emerging demand trends and country-level import patterns while integrating macroeconomic and trade datasets such as GDP and population forecasts, bilateral import–export flows, tariff structures, elasticity differentials between developed and developing economies, geographic distance, and import demand projections. Using weighted trade values from 2020–2024 as the base period to project country-to-country export potential for 2030, these inputs are operationalized through calculated drivers such as gravity model parameters, tariff impact factors, and projected GDP per-capita growth. Through an analysis of hidden potentials, demand hotspots, and market conditions that are most favorable to success, this method enables firms to focus on target countries, maximize returns, and global expansion with data, backed by accuracy.
By factoring in the projected importer demand gap that is currently unmet and could be potential opportunity, it identifies the potential for the Exporter (Country) among 190 countries, against the general trade analysis, which identifies the biggest importer or exporter.
